Vent: Overheard a contractor say plywood "doesn't matter" for cabinet boxes

I was grabbing supplies at my local lumber yard in Denver and heard a young guy telling his partner that any old plywood works for case construction since it's "hidden anyway." He was talking about using standard sheathing instead of cabinet-grade plywood to save $15 a sheet. How do we get these newcomers to understand that a cabinet built with warped, void-filled plywood will fail in 3 or 4 years no matter how good the face frame looks?
